Identifying your target audience

The first and most important aspect of marketing is identifying your target audience. It is not enough to know what they want; you must also be able to provide them with the product or service they need in order to attain their goals.

For example, if you are a car dealer looking to sell cars but have no idea who your customers are, then it would be difficult for you to find out what kind of cars they want and how much money they have available for buying one.

 The only way that you can make an educated guess at this is by using data analysis software or surveys (which can cost thousands of dollars). In order to determine who your customers are and how much money they have available for buying cars, you need to do some research on demographics, age groups, and location.

Identifying your target audience is one of the most important aspects of marketing. You should know who they are, what their needs are, and how to reach them. In order to do this, you will need to conduct a market research study and find out what people are looking for in terms of products or services that you can provide.

You may also want to consider conducting focus groups in order to get more insight into how people feel about your product or service. A lot of times by doing this you can discover things that you hadn't previously considered and may find that there is room for improvement in your marketing strategy.

Creating the content (advertisements, blog articles) that will be effective in reaching the target audience

Creating content (advertisements, blog articles) that will effectively reach the target audience is one of the most important aspects of marketing.

In order to create content that can attract your target audience and convince them to take action, you need to know what they love. You also have to know what they hate and avoid it. This is where your "marketing research" comes into play.

You can do this by asking them questions or by conducting surveys. You should also keep track of their interests on social media platforms so that you can use this information when creating content that will appeal to them.

For example, if you are selling jewelry online, you should find out from your customers' social media profiles whether they tend to buy jewelry during specific events or times of the year such as Valentine's Day or Mother's Day. 

If so, then you should include those items in your online store so that customers can purchase them easily when these events come around again next year!

The content you create should be relevant to your current and future audience. It should be clear and concise, but not too short or long.

This means that the content must contain enough information for the target audience to understand it. You also need to keep in mind that some people might not have time to read everything you have written. Therefore, you should make sure that your content is easy to understand and digest.

One of the most important aspects of marketing is monitoring responses from the target audience to determine the effectiveness of your marketing efforts so you know what's working and what isn't.

Monitoring response is also important because it helps you create a plan for future promotions or campaigns. It will also help you make adjustments to future campaigns based on the results that you've seen so far. If a particular campaign doesn't seem to be working, then you might want to try something different next time.

For example, if there's a promotion running where people are getting a free gift with their purchase, then monitoring response could tell you whether people are taking advantage of this offer or not. If they aren't, then maybe next time around you should give out more free gifts instead of just one.

Build a website that becomes the central point for your marketing.

Building a website that becomes the central point for your marketing is critical. A website should be your primary tool for communicating with customers, selling products and services, and educating them about your brand.

Your website should be built to support these goals:

Provide a central location on the web where customers can find you and learn about your company.

Provide a place where customers can sign up for e-newsletter lists or other communications (such as sales pitches) that are relevant to their needs.

Allow customers to order products and services through your site.

Allow customers to share content and information about your company with others.
